1. Twins Do Not Have the Same Fingerprints.

Identical twins share a lot of resemblance, and DNA. But one thing about them is always very different -- their fingertips. Since fingertips are not only based on a person's DNA, but on various factors such as nutrition, growth rate and hormonal levels in the womb, two identical twins will have unique sets of ridges and lines that construct their fingertips.
